We had a great stay at this inn during our trip to Perhentian Island! 🌴 It’s great value for money — perfect for those looking for a clean, comfortable stay without breaking the bank. The room and toilet were spotless, and the air-conditioning was a huge plus after a long day out in the sun. It’s also in a super convenient location, just a short walk to Long Beach, but tucked away enough to enjoy some peace and quiet. The staff were friendly and helpful, making check-in and daily needs really smooth. Just a small tip: bring mosquito repellent, as the inn is surrounded by trees — part of the charm, but nature comes with company! 😅 Highly recommend for anyone looking for a cozy, well-priced stay on the island!

Our experience was quite disappointing. The room had no air conditioning, only a fan, which made it almost unbearable to stay inside because it was so hot and humid. A positive point was that there were mosquito nets, but the windows couldn’t be properly closed. This meant it was very noisy early in the morning when people passed by.

Another issue was the check-in time. On the booking platform, it clearly said check-in was possible from 2 PM, but at the hotel we were told it’s only from 3 PM. When we mentioned what the booking site said, the staff just replied that it doesn’t apply and we have to follow their own rules, which didn’t make sense to us.

There was also no Wi-Fi in the room, and due to a network outage, there was no mobile reception either—so essentially no internet at all. Because there was no air conditioning, the room stayed extremely humid. Nothing dried properly, so after just one day the towels already smelled bad, and they weren’t replaced.

On top of that, the bed linens were stained, the duvets were too small, and the windows couldn’t be fully darkened. Overall, the stay was very uncomfortable and not what we expected.

That being said, when looking at some of the other accommodations we passed by, such as the tent areas, this place still seems decent in comparison. You can definitely sleep there while staying on the Perhentian Islands. However, whether the price matches the value you get—I highly doubt it.
